  • Patent number: 5383112
    Abstract: A method of managing information used and generated in the scheduling and exhibition of performances is disclosed. A video network includes a video server that operates several video recorders to simultaneously exhibit video performances or programs on a plurality of channels. The video server is controlled in real time in accordance with data presented to it in an exhibition plan. The exhibition plan is generated through the performance of an exhibition manager process which operates on a computer. The exhibition manager manages information related to the performances to be exhibited, schedules the performances in accordance with user-supplied timing data, prints reports, and maintains a personal information manager having a database describing studios, contacts, and other information related to licensing the performances for exhibition on the network. The information related to performances includes repeat factors and short titles which the exhibition manager calculates.
